TRIB3 opens Madrid club, prepares to enter Finnish market
Boutique studio brand TRIB3 has launched a flagship club in Madrid, igniting a busy period of international openings for the brand.
The Madrid launch is the first of two in the city, and comes ahead of the re-launch of its existing Barcelona studio in March 2019.
The 4,000sq ft Madrid studio will house 42 workout stations and sits in the financial district of Cuzco.
Kevin Yates, TRIB3 CEO, said the launch – undertaken in partnership with health and fitness group Holmes Place – is a "game changer" for the company.
"The launch of our flagship studio in Madrid sees us building on the successes we’re experiencing in the UK, especially and refining our model to suit a new market," Yates said.
"It forms a core part of our expansion strategy and demonstrates our ambitions to work with other investors and partners in major cities across the globe.”
The Madrid opening will be followed by TRIB3's entry into the Finnish fitness market.
The operator will open a studio in the capital city Helsinki in February, closely followed by a launch in the city of Tampere.
TRIB3 President Rod Hill, who is spearheading the company’s international expansion, added: “Our international rollout programme is now in full swing.
"We have had a huge amount of interest from countries across the globe interested in partnering with us to develop TRIB3 across multiple regions, and look forward to announcing future launches imminently.”
As well as its UK and Spanish studios, TRIB3 has a presence in China and Russia.
TRIB3's boutique format is based on bootcamp-style HIIT training, offering group programming and interaction through digital and performance monitors.
